Description

As a Senior or Staff Mechanical Engineer, you will design, develop, test, and operate planetary rovers and related hardware. You will be responsible for producing high-performance designs for challenging environments, with cradle-to-grave accountability. You will have the opportunity to develop and mentor other engineers while working on novel, complex mechanical systems.

What you'll do:
  • Design mechanical systems (structures, mechanisms, electro-mechanical, thermal, etc.) at both architectural and detailed levels
  • Own hardware products through the entire life cycle, from requirements definition all the way through to operational mission success and beyond
  • Produce detailed design documentation, including models, drawings, analysis packages, test plans, test reports, certification compliance, operations plans, and more
  • Build tools and infrastructure to make your team and the company more efficient
  • Work with leadership and design counterparts to define Astrolab best practices for design, analysis, and test
